6. e difference is almost 50 3 3 Battery Replacement Note The instrument will not be started when the battery is weakening Replace the battery immediately Loosen the three screws with suitable driver and remove the bottom cover Replace the degraded battery with a new DC 9V battery e Model 1604 006P or other equivalent battery must be used Alkaline battery is recommended e If the instrument is not in use for more than three months if the external DC adapter is always be used please take out the battery e Close the bottom cover The degraded battery must be disposed of properly 3 4 Clearing Instruction To clean the instrument use a soft cloth slightly dipped in water Do not spray cleanser directly onto the instrument since it may leak into the cabinet and cause damage Do not use chemicals containing benzine alcohol or aromatic hydrocarbons Appendix Message Code Table clear Clear Correction OPEN Open Open correction Short Short Short correction P17 P1 High limit of P1 Bin P1 P1 Low limit of P1 Bin Ng NG No Good q Q Low limit of quality factor d D High limit of dissipation factor Std Std Standard value Nominal value APO APO Auto Power Off CAL CAL Accuracy Calibration PSd PSD Password ALErt Alert ON ON OFF OFF PASS Pass FAIL Fail Quit Quit PEGE WWW AXIDMET EU 13 First Edition2006 2 WWW AXIOMET EU 14

8. nditions are changed such as test fixture and environment temperature 2 It is recommended to perform the open and short correction at the same time 3 During short correction period FAIL FAIL will be displayed in the secondary parameter display area when short correction is failed Make sure that the measurement contacts are shorted reliably and perform the short correction again 4 The meter measures the correction data at all frequency points and all measurement ranges The correction data is stored in the non volatile memory So you don t have to perform the correction again if the test conditions are not changed 5 Open and short corrections are automatically selected by the instrument according to the impedance value under test If there is a component in the fixture or if there is error with the instrument Quit Quit will be displayed in the secondary parameter display area 6 Equivalent Circuit Press EQU key to select the Series or Parallel circuit mode Note 1 The actual C R and L are not the ideal pure C R and L Normally an actual component can be regarded as the combination of an ideal resistor and an ideal reactor in series or parallel circuit mode 2 The meter can convert between the two different equivalent circuit modes using the following equations The measurement values of the two different circuit modes maybe different under different quality factor Q or dissipation factor D Capacitance Cp fr
